Pablo Escobar’s Home Is Demolished in Colombia, Along With a Painful Legacy By News February 23, 2019 Add Comment Edit A blast leveled the Monaco building, the former home of drug kingpin Pablo Escobar in Medellín, Colombia, on Friday.
